Online shopping
is the process consumers go through
to purchase products or services over the Internet.

Online shoppers can easily learn from previous experiences of different products, mostly by reading user or expert reviews. Reading online product reviews is usually the first step in online shopping, which plays an important role in customers' decisions.

Many online stores such as Amazon.com and Newegg today allow customers to comment or rate their items. There are also dedicated review sites (e.g. Epinions, etc.) to host user reviews for different products.

It is important to do business with reputable online stores to avoid possible Internet fraud and to easily exchange or return when things go wrong. Again, shoppers often read store ratings or reviews by other customers if they are not familiar with some online stores. An advantage of shopping online is being able to use the power of the internet to seek out the lowest prices or the best deals available for items or services.

Onlineshopping is a gigantic industry, and with good reason, too. Few shopping methods offer more convenience, better prices, or better information access than shopping via the internet. However, it pays to follow a few precautions when shopping on the internet.

Secure Shopping

When ordering from an online site, one of the first things you should check is to see that their order page is secure. The page you enter your address and contact details on doesn't need to be secure, but the page you enter your credit card on should be.

The easiest way to tell that a page is secure is that it will start with https. Also, in Internet Explorer, you'll see a yellow padlock at the bottom of your browser window.

Reputable Merchant

You should also do at least a little research to ensure that the website you are ordering from is a reputable, dependable merchant. There are several ways to check on the reputability of a merchant: Are they listed with the Better Business Bureau? Are they members of any other third party verification entities? Check their customer reviews on third party sites like Alexa.com, BizRate.com, and Shopzilla.com

If you're purchasing from a seller on an online marketplace like Ebay or Amazon Marketplace, check their ratings and customer feedback. Most online marketplaces offer some kind of a guarantee against fraud for orders placed on their website.

Company policies

Also check on the companies policies before you order from them. You should check that they have at least some kind of a guarantee and return policy. Also, how quickly do they ship orders? What customer service do they offer? Do they have full contact info on their website, including their physical address and phone number?

With a little research, you can save some time and money by shopping online - and not worry about not getting your money's worth!
